Output e8056b1da1c2ccfff89b281417dee90f8e6a902f2e86fa174b0b9fe74e01f482:7

value
25517113
script pubkey
OP_0 OP_PUSHBYTES_32 dd2f88518915dc3f882660aa9cc02676d2be9d8b258a5723942858043dc8ab86
address
bc1qm5hcs5vfzhwrlzpxvz4fespxwmfta8vtyk99wgu59pvqg0wg4wrqk37erg
transaction
e8056b1da1c2ccfff89b281417dee90f8e6a902f2e86fa174b0b9fe74e01f482
spent
true